5 Needed Tools for Every Security Guard
Protecting assets and ensuring the safety of personnel requires a vigilant approach. Every security guard needs more than just a keen eye; they need the right tools to do their job effectively. Here are five must-have items that every security professional should carry:
- Tactical Light: Essential for navigating dark areas and spotting potential threats.
- Radio Communication Device: Maintains quick and reliable communication with colleagues and command center.
- Medical Supplies: Prepared for minor ailments
- Pepper Spray: A non-lethal option for subduing aggressive individuals.
- Log Book: For recording observations, incidents, and important details.
